/// <summary> /// Nodes between two points, compressed at both ends /// </summary> /// <param name="l">lower limit.</param> /// <param name="r">upper limit.</param> /// <param name="a">scaling between linear ans sinus-mapping</param> /// <param name="n">number of nodes</param> /// <returns></returns> public static double[] SinLinSpacing(double l, double r, double a, int n) { if (a < 0) { throw new ArgumentOutOfRangeException(); } if (a > 1) { throw new ArgumentOutOfRangeException(); } if (l >= r) { throw new ArgumentOutOfRangeException(); } double[] linnodes = GenericBlas.Linspace(-Math.PI * 0.5, Math.PI * 0.5, n); double[] linnodes2 = GenericBlas.Linspace(-1, 1, n); double[] nodes = new double[n]; for (int i = 0; i < n; i++) { //nodes[i] = linnodes2[i] * (1 - a) + (1.0 - Math.Sin(linnodes[i])) * a; nodes[i] = linnodes2[i] * (1 - a) + Math.Sin(linnodes[i]) * a; } for (int i = 0; i < n; i++) { nodes[i] = nodes[i] * (r - l) * 0.5 + (r + l) * 0.5; //Debug.Assert(nodes[i] >= l); //Debug.Assert(nodes[i] <= r); } return(nodes); }
